I had the carpet getting soaked in the corner by the closet. I had some heavy black plastic, pulled the slide in a ways, poked the plastic between the carpet and slide (covering the exposed carpet that you can feel from outside)--- put the slide back out - no leaks or soaked carpet.
 
We had the same leaks on are 2006, After several tries they found the leaks at the outside drain holes in the windows.When they insluted the windows the workers accidently pluged the holes with cocking. The water has nowhere to go but inside.

We had water in our slide area after a rain storm--the tape on the slide out roof along the edge was "loose". We put new Dicor roof silicone stuff on it along with the Eternabond tape--no problems since then. It seems that the water ran down the wall and that was the reason the carpet was wet. Check the roof out, as that may be ther sorce of the water.
I had same problem, the water came in from the bottom of the slide out not the sides, look @ the underside of your slide out, their
is a strip of metal, it's the old strip where a vinyl run would be placed, this fills w/water and seeps onto your floor, I filled this w/
a sealeant and it has not leaked since.
 
Our problem was the slide had moved to far one way so the slide seal on one side wasn't doing it's job. The side seal should have an equal angle against the side of the slide.
